Overview

The NEBOSH International Diploma is the natural progression after the NEBOSH International General Certificate, aimed at people becoming leaders in occupational health and safety management rather than only practitioners.

It is significantly more demanding than the IGC, both in depth of content and in the level of independent study required, and we would rather be upfront about that than understate it. Learners who commit to the IDip are typically aiming for senior HSE roles where this level of technical depth is expected.

Career opportunities

The IDip is typically the final formal step before senior HSE leadership roles, often combined with chartered membership of a professional body such as IOSH.
